WebStudents who have less than six credit hours of remaining Bright Futures eligibility, or who need fewer than six credit hours to graduate, may be funded if enrolled for less than six credit hours. Graduating students will need to complete a graduation application to be awarded for less than six credit hours. WebBright Futures Status and GPA. WebBright Futures disburses at a rate, specific to your scholarship, to cover the base fee of the course. Bright Futures does not cover additional class charges, such as online fees. Any additional fees not covered by Bright Futures will be your responsibility to pay. The Academic Scholarship pays $213.55 per credit hour. Florida Bright Futures is a merit-based scholarship for Florida residents … WebBright Futures eligible students will either have the Academic Scholarship, which pays $213.55 per credit hour, or the Medallion Scholarship, which pays $160.16 per credit hour. Students who have been awarded the Academic Scholarship will also receive an additional $300 book award from Bright Futures.

WebFlorida Medallion Scholars (sometimes referred to as 75% Bright Futures) will receive an award to cover 75% of tuition and applicable fees while attending Florida State University. At FSU, tuition and applicable fees covers the following; tuition, financial aid fee, capital improvement fee, health fee, health plus fee, counseling center fee ...
